Staffordshire, Kinver Parish - Temporary Footpacth Closure, to allow for works to the bridle bridge.
What is happening?
STAFFORDSHIRE COUNTY COUNCIL
ROAD TRAFFIC REGULATION ACT 1984 – (AS AMENDED)
ROAD TRAFFIC (TEMPORARY RESTRICTIONS) ACT 1991
THE STAFFORDSHIRE COUNTY COUNCIL
PUBLIC BRIDLEWAY NO. 95 KINVER PARISH
(TEMPORARY CLOSURE) ORDER 2026
Notice is hereby given that the Staffordshire County Council on 13/11/25 made an Order the effect of which will be to prohibit any users from proceeding along the section of Public Bridleway No. 95 from Hyde Lane to its junction with the A458 for approximately 3.5 km The closure is required under the provision of the Road Traffic Regulations Act 1984 Section 14 (1) (b) due to the unsafe condition of the bridle bridge and subsequent works required. No alternative route is available.
A plan will be displayed on site to show the length of path to be closed and unaffected rights of way in the area.
This Order came into operation on 17/11/25 and has been extended for a further period of twelve months, until 16/5/27 or until the risk of danger to the public is over, whichever is the earlier. This extension has been given approval by the Secretary of State. If necessary, the Order may be extended for a further period.
